Milwaukee's DSPS Licensing: The Unseen Ranking Factor for Fire Damage Restoration
The Wisconsin Department of Safety and Professional Services (DSPS) contractor license is not merely a legal requirement for Milwaukee Fire Damage Restoration companies; it's a critical E-E-A-T signal Google uses to validate expertise and trustworthiness. Many local firms, while compliant offline, fail to integrate their specific DSPS license number and verification links prominently on their websites. This omission creates a trust deficit, especially when homeowners in Riverwest are searching for immediate, reliable fire damage repair. Google's algorithms are designed to prioritize authoritative sources, and explicit display of state-level licensing acts as a powerful, verifiable anchor for your site's credibility. Furthermore, schema markup for 'LocalBusiness' should include the 'hasCertification' property, linking directly to your DSPS license profile. This technical detail, often overlooked by 90% of Milwaukee Fire Damage Restoration websites, provides a direct, machine-readable signal to search engines, significantly enhancing your site's authority for critical local queries. Without this, even a technically sound site struggles against competitors who leverage these foundational trust elements.

Three Critical Website Failures for Milwaukee Fire Damage Restoration Firms
Milwaukee Fire Damage Restoration companies frequently make three critical errors that impede their online visibility. First, neglecting localized content: a generic 'services' page fails to mention specific Milwaukee neighborhoods like Sherman Park or Walker's Point, or local landmarks, which dilutes relevance for local search queries. Your content must explicitly reference Milwaukee-specific fire safety regulations or common local damage scenarios. Second, a lack of structured data for emergency services: most sites do not implement 'EmergencyService' schema markup, which allows Google to display your business more prominently for urgent 'fire damage near me' searches. This is a missed opportunity for immediate lead generation. Third, failing the 'Reasonable Surfer' test on mobile: with 70%+ of emergency searches coming from mobile, a slow-loading, non-responsive site with small text and difficult navigation is immediately abandoned. Your Milwaukee Fire Damage Restoration website must prioritize mobile UX, ensuring critical information like your 24/7 emergency line is instantly accessible. Addressing these specific deficiencies will position your firm to capture a larger share of Milwaukee's urgent fire damage calls.
